Data engineering is the process of designing and implementing solutions that allow data to be used effectively and efficiently. It involves designing and building systems that manage, process, analyze, and display data. It can help companies extract value from their data to make better decisions.

What are the skills and experience a data engineer should have?

A data engineer should have a strong understanding of computer science and statistics. They should also be able to design and implement effective database systems and analyze data to find trends. A data engineer should also be familiar with different programming languages, including SQL and Python.

What are the benefits of having a data engineer on your team?

Having a data engineer on your team can improve the efficiency of your data processing. A data engineer can help you design efficient data pipelines and make sure that your data is properly cleaned and prepared for analysis. They can also help you create new insights from your data and recommend ways to improve your business processes.

Data engineers can also help you with the management of your data. They can help you understand how your data is used and how it can be improved. They can also provide support in areas such as Big Data and cloud storage.
